    I'm installing a new hu & amp. I have a pigtail harness plugged into the back of the hu and another pigtail harness that plugs into the existing car wiring. Rca cables run from hu to amp. If preamp outputs are used, does hu output signal on speaker leads? Do I connect the both harness together for the front/rear speaker wires and then splice the speaker wire coming from amp into the harness or leave the speaker leads coming from the hu taped off and just tie the speaker leads from the amp into the harness that connects into the existing wiring.

    there should be an option in the HU to turn off the internal amplifier to increase RCA performance.

    if your going to amplify the signal of your speakers then you won't go through the stereo. just cut the speaker wiring going to the head unit then run new wires going to the amp and tape off the wires that were going into the head unit for the speakers.
